Transaction 6347866cbfaa63012061fd28a365cb9ee512e0face097724dc9fc4cad89a670b
1 Input
1 Output
-
6347866cbfaa63012061fd28a365cb9ee512e0face097724dc9fc4cad89a670b:0
- value
- 10721425
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e7db4ebef9ff7e75b420bdfdd3e758ef9d1c3b1
- address
- bc1qde7mf6l0nlm7wk6zp00a60n43muarsa32fgs3y